ABSTRACT:
Highly sensitive, fiber optical cables, embedded in titanium, and remaining free from the refractive distortion ordinarily attributable to the presence of diffused titanium molecules in the fiber, are made possible by an optical fiber-intermetallic composite having a titanium aluminide barrier layer between the optical fiber material and a titanium matrix material. The composite forms a useful means of optically sensing and monitoring the environmental and structural disturbances to which titanium aircraft structures are exposed.
